A diversified approach that includes gold ETFs, physical bullion, and mining equities can hedge against both inflation and currency risks. Given the Fed's projected rate cuts and the broader macroeconomic tailwinds-geopolitical tensions, central bank demand, and a weaker dollar-gold's role as a strategic asset is unlikely to wane.
The Federal Reserve's 2025 policy journey has been a masterclass in communication's power to shape markets. Powell's nuanced messaging-oscillating between dovish reassurances and hawkish caution-has created a volatile but fertile environment for gold. For investors, the lesson is clear: in an era of economic uncertainty and shifting policy signals, gold remains a critical tool for hedging against inflation, currency devaluation, and geopolitical risks. As the Fed's December meeting approaches, the interplay between central bank communication and gold's price trajectory will continue to define the investment landscape.
